Fixing Konica Minolta bizhub C224 Error C-2559
The Konica Minolta bizhub C224 error C-2559 indicates a failure in the toner supply motor. This issue prevents the machine from effectively adding toner to the developer unit, which could lead to faded prints. Learning how to fix error C-2559 in bizhub C224 involves inspecting the toner motor mechanism.
Common causes
- 1Toner supply motor jam.
- 2Defective toner cartridge mechanism.
- 3Toner sensor blockage.
- 4Internal board communication error.
Solutions
Quick Diagnosis
If the error persists after resetting, check the message history to see if it identifies a specific color cartridge. This points directly to a single toner hopper mechanism.Step-by-step Solution
- Access Toner: Open the front panel.
- Inspection: Verify if the toner cartridge moves freely.
- Cleaning: Blow out any toner dust around the sensor.
- Power Cycle: Reset the machine to clear the diagnostic code.
Prevention and Maintenance
Use genuine TN-321 toner kits only. Keep the internal cabinet vacuumed to prevent toner particles from coating the delicate internal sensors.When to call a technician
If the motor makes grinding noises or the error returns immediately, the motor unit needs professional replacement.Technical specifications
